Would there ever come a time where we have a number in mind that we might have to put a cap on the North Slave region and look at trying to promote getting, in particular, aurora tourism operators out into some of the other regions so that the benefits of this growth can be had by some of the other outlying regions?
I just want to quickly share one story, because I know I am limited on time here. The Standing Committee on Economic Development and Environment held our strategic planning meetings up in Norman Wells this summer, and every second person that I ran into asked me, "How can we get our hands on some of that Yellowknife tourism boom that is going on?" That is why I raise the question. Thank you, Mr. Chair.
